
Nedry Tour Diary // Day 4
Bournemouth – The Winchester
Following the 6Music Breakfast Radio session, we headed out to our distributor to pick up some additional merchandise for the tour. It probably takes about as long as to drive to the north of england from the south as it does to drive from east to west London and after a short bit of road rage around Fulham we were on our way to Bournemouth for our show at The Winchester, which was on Poole Road.
We were also very excited at the prospect of staying in our first Travelodge of the tour. It is one of many. We read an article written by the drummer from Blood Red Shoes a while back, which was a band on tour do’s and don’ts, and he was absolutely right. They’re cheap, clean and comfortable. But it does smell like a burst air freshener has exploded across the building.
Bournemouth was very quiet. The Winchester, a very cool looking pub venue with a huge and towering stage was our spot for performance. There were no other bands on the bill and we were not going on until 1AM! Needless to say, following a 6am start with Radio6, this wasn’t exactly welcome. At least the 15 people who were in the venue seemed to somewhat enjoy it. The night was a bit of a washout but we’re learning as we go along that we must take the rough with the smooth. Gigging at this level is always an unknown quantity.
Some gigs that we play you can hear that the soundman gets it within the first song and everything sounds great quite quickly, others it takes a while for things to sound right. This was the first time that a soundman got it right so quick that he grew bored and decided that Jimi Hendrix style surround sound panning and slap-back delay on everything was a great idea. Well, it was different, but anyway this just reminded us how great the soundmen had been up to this point, it’s another learning curve with touring at this level.
